Analysis
The most recent figure for manure applied to soils — indirect emissions in Mozambique is 2.04 kt, measured in 2050. That is the highest value across all 65 years on record.
Over the whole period, manure applied to soils — indirect emissions in Mozambique peaked at 2.04 kt in 2050 and was at its lowest, 0.0285 kt, in 1961.
Mozambique ranks 23rd of 195 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
